Abstract

The utility model discloses strong-acid proof and strong-base proof protective clothing rubberized fabric which comprises a skeleton layer 1; an upper rubber layer 2 and a lower rubber layer 3 are arranged on the upper surface and the lower surface of the skeleton layer 1; and a polyethylene layer 4 is installed on the upper surface of the upper rubber layer 2. Compared with the prior acid proof and base proof chemical protective clothing applicable to 60 percent nitric acid, 80 percent sulfuric acid, 30 percent hydrochloric acid and 6 mol sodium hydroxide solution, a protective clothing made of the novel protective clothing rubberized fabric is applicable to 96 percent nitric acid, 98 percent sulfuric acid, 36-38 percent hydrochloric acid and saturated sodium hydroxide solution. The acid proof and base proof penetrability of the protective clothing made of the novel fabric is greatly enhanced, and the protective clothing can offer more excellent protection for a user of the protective clothing.

(2) background technology:
The existing domestic chemical protection of generally using is taken various adhesive plasters and is comprised a casing play, respectively covers one deck rubber layer or plastics tree resin layer on the upper and lower surface of casing play.Described casing play generally adopts materials such as cotton, polyvinyl cloth, polyamide fabric, woven dacron or nonwoven polypropylene fabric, rubber layer then adopts natural rubber, neoprene, nitrile rubber, CSM, butyl rubber, polyurethane rubber etc. mostly, and the plastics ester is generally polyvinyl chloride, polyurethane plastics.Because the performance difference of various elastomeric materials makes the protective garment adhesive plaster of preparation possess different characteristics, and is comparatively soft as natural rubber protective garment adhesive plaster, but resistance to chemical attack is poor, and fast light also lower with the oxygen performance; Chlorosulfonated polyethylene and neoprene protective garment adhesive plaster resistance to ag(e)ing are better, but resistance to low temperature poor, be prone to the low temperature problem of hardening; The better heat stability of butyl rubber protective garment adhesive plaster, but oil resistant, Weather-resistant and anti-some chemical mediator are then not enough; And polyurethane rubber protective garment adhesive plaster anti-wear performance is good, and anti-highly acid is relatively poor.In addition, the anti-general chemical dielectric behavior of polyvinyl chloride and vinyl chloride is good in the plastics, but very property greatly, is easily hardened, and the flexibility of makeing the protective garment adhesive plaster is relatively poor.And the chemical protecting suit scope of application of existing domestic production is 60% nitric acid, 80% sulfuric acid, 30% hydrochloric acid, 6mol sodium hydroxide solution.
(3) utility model content:
It is good that the utility model will disclose flexibility, and anti-strong acid, alkali corrosion are good, and good acid and alkali-resistance penetrability is arranged, and are particularly suitable for making the protective garment adhesive plaster of strong acid, highly basic protective garment; The utility model is also with the protective garment of this protective garment adhesive plaster of public use.
This novel protective garment adhesive plaster comprises casing play, and the upper and lower surface of casing play is respectively equipped with rubber layer and following rubber layer, and last rubber layer upper surface is provided with polyethylene layer; Study repeatedly, test through the applicant, and take all factors into consideration chemical mediator performances such as the flexibility of protective garment and acid and alkali resistance, discovery is provided with the flexibility that one polyethylene layer not only can keep adhesive plaster at last rubber layer upper surface, can also utilize the resistance to chemical corrosion of polyethylene excellence to improve the permeability of anti-strong acid, alkali corrosion and the extraordinary chemical mediator of protective garment adhesive plaster, also improve simultaneously anti-day aging ability of protective garment adhesive plaster, prolonged the service life of protective garment.Wherein, the material of described casing play can adopt existing protective garment casing play material, as materials such as cotton, polyvinyl cloth, polyamide fabric, woven dacron or nonwoven polypropylene fabric; Also can adopt existing protective garment elastomeric material and go up rubber layer with following rubber layer, but preferably select the elastomeric material of better softness for use, as natural rubber, butyl rubber, polyurethane rubber, neoprene etc.
For making protective garment can keep better flexibility and possessing good resistance to chemical corrosion, described polyethylene layer thickness is generally 0.005~0.1mm; And the preferable range of the thickness of polyethylene layer is 0.01~0.03mm, in this scope, being used of polyethylene layer and upper and lower rubber layer possesses anti-strong acid, the alkali corrosion performance of best raising protective garment adhesive plaster integral body, also can not influence the flexibility of protective garment.
Be the corrosivity of chemical mediators such as the anti-strong acid that further improves the protective garment adhesive plaster, highly basic, and guarantee the flexibility of protection adhesive plaster, the described thickness of going up rubber layer and following rubber layer generally is 0.05~0.5mm; And the preferable range that goes up rubber layer and following rubber layer thickness is 0.1~0.3mm.
When making this novel protective garment adhesive plaster, can adopt existing process method apply upper and lower rubber layer respectively on the upper and lower surface of casing play with existing glue spreader, calender earlier, and then employing be coated with and be covered with polyethylene layer at last rubber layer upper surface with quadrat method.
The utility model also includes the protective garment that above-mentioned protective garment adhesive plaster is made.
With this novel protective garment adhesive plaster is that material can cutting be made the novel protective garment of basis of each model.
Because this novel protective garment adhesive plaster upper surface of rubber layer on the casing play is provided with one polyethylene layer again, make the protective garment adhesive plaster when can keeping whole flexibility, the performance of its anti-strong acid in effective life, the infiltration of alkali corrosion performance is compared also with existing protective garment adhesive plaster and is improved.The protective garment scope of application that adopts this novel protective garment adhesive plaster manufacturing is 96% nitric acid, 98% sulfuric acid, 36~38% hydrochloric acid, saturated sodium hydroxide solution, and the concentration index of anti-strong acid, highly basic is far above domestic existing acid-fast alkali-proof protective garment.
